# Payroll export moved from fixed-width to delimited format per the
# Ledgerbird v4 spec. Downstream at Finch & Sons' clearing system still
# expects padded amounts, so we keep padding behind a flag until they
# migrate. Field widths, decimal precision, and the batch cutoff are
# constants here, not config, to keep exports reproducible across
# environments. Flag flip is targeted for next quarter; raise at sync
# if that slips. Current constants follow.

tuning table, faduf-baduf:
PRIORITIES = {
    "ulavan": 191,
    "silys": 750,
    "goriel": 238,
    "kelmir": 66,
    "wendor": 432,
}

## Runbook: ParityPeek rate checker

Quick heads-up for the security review: ParityPeek scrapes partner hotel rates every 20 minutes and diffs them against our published prices for the Brindlewood chain. Scraper creds live in the vault under the parity namespace, rotated weekly. If diffs spike above 5%, it pages the revenue on-call — nothing auto-corrects, humans decide. All outbound fetches go through the egress proxy, fully logged. The currently deployed build is recorded below.

trace token, kahog-tajeg: htk6_97d963

Dear team assistants,

Please note that the quiet room on the top floor of Penhallow House is now reserved-use only between 09:00 and 12:00 each weekday. Bookings must be logged with the front desk in advance, and occupants should vacate promptly at the scheduled end time. The door entry code is below.

door code, yagap-bahof: bdg-O-05

Checklist item 7: Telemetry payload compression. Verify that all Skylark agents emit gzip-compressed payloads, that the fallback to uncompressed mode is logged and alerted, and that compression ratios stay within the agreed budget. Flag any regression for discussion at the weekly sync. Outstanding exceptions must be approved by the owner named below.

account owner for bawip-tahag: Raleth Quenok